Saba Capital sells BlackRock ESG (ECAT) shares worth $594,729
Saba Capital has successfully sold its shares in BlackRock's ESG fund, ECAT, for a substantial amount of $594,729. This move highlights Saba's strategic investment decisions and reflects the growing interest in sustainable investing. The sale not only showcases Saba's ability to capitalize on market opportunities but also emphasizes the importance of ESG criteria in today's investment landscape.
